Global Marine Segment Manager, Cruise
As the Global Marine Segment Manager, Cruise
, you will develop the growth strategy for this segment. Within the cruise market you are responsible for our Drydock, Seastock and New Build proposition. As part of the execution, you will be a business developer side by side with the sales teams. You will work with sales, platform management, product management, marketing, technical, and supply chain functions. You will report to the Global Marine Sea Stock Segment Director.
Accomplish segment strategy based on understanding of customer needs, industry and competitive dynamics, and PPG position.
Improve knowledgebase of market landscape including market as a whole, segmentation of market, opportunities, current competitive landscape, and current PPG business and position within the market.
Industry and competitors: monitor and evaluate industry and competitor developments, marketing actions, products, position, and strengths and weaknesses to anticipate competitor response to SBU plans.
Be a central point to coordinate with other responsibilities within business to ensure segment strategies are globally implemented.
Plan and accomplish Business Development activities.
Functionally coordinate with regional sales managers to ensure mutual understanding of expectations.
Prepare segment targeted value propositions in collaboration with the regional sales, product, testing and certification and technical teams.
Collaborate with Marketing Communication teams to create the relevant content and cascade these into internal sales training and external sales and marketing activities.
Provide in-depth support for regions to identify and pursue opportunities, ensuring training and selling tools relevant to their segments are available and deployed.
Monitor the pipeline using resources like Salesforce and ensure important projects.
Ensure coverage and proper management of main accounts in sub-segment.
Qualifications- Network and equivalent relations in the Cruise market
- Bachelor's degree in engineering, chemistry, business, or related degree.
- At least 10 years' experience in strategy, marketing, business development or sales within the coatings industry and cruise market.
- Proficiency in gathering and analyzing market intelligence.
- Assemble and organize multiple sources into a clear market assessment.
- Translate/measure data and other information and make reliable decisions on viable business prospect identification.
- Exposure to global business dynamics and the ability to guide implementation of required activities across all regions.
